Join Our Team at Hills! We are looking for a Weighbridge Operative to join our team in Calne. This is a full‑time, permanent role with a competitive salary and a fantastic benefits package.
What is the role all about? As our Weighbridge Operative you’ll be managing the smooth and efficient operation of our weighbridge office, ensuring vehicles are accurately weighed and processed in and out of the site using our computerised weighing system.
What you will be doing:
- Act as the first point of contact for drivers and visitors to the site, providing a welcoming and professional service
- Accurately maintain site records, both manually and using electronic systems
- Carry out a range of general administrative duties to support site operations
- Handle incoming telephone calls and respond to enquiries efficiently and courteously
What we are looking for:
Essential
- Confidence using IT systems, including Microsoft Office applications
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to deal confidently with a range of people
- Excellent administrative skills and a high level of attention to detail
- The ability to work effectively as part of a team
- Good organisational skills, with the ability to prioritise workload in a busy environment
Desirable
- Experience in a similar role or within the waste industry
